Women's Volleyball: Bethany opens the season with wins against Baldwin Wallace and Hiram

SANDUSKY, Ohio – Bethany College women's volleyball team earned a pair of victories to open up the 2023 season Friday at the Great Lakes Crossover held at the Cedar Point Sports Complex. Bethany took the first game from Baldwin Wallace in three sets and handed Hiram a 3-1 loss in the second match of the evening.

THE MATCHUP

  • Bethany 3, Baldwin Wallace 0 (25-17, 25-23, 25-17)
  • Bethany 3, Hiram 1 (25-20, 33-31, 12-25, 25-18)

 

MATCH NOTES

  • The Bison were picked first in the annual Presidents' Athletic Conference (PAC) preseason polls and have everyone returning that were a part of the program's third PAC Championship last season.
  • In the match against Hiram, three Bison had 10+ kills led by Sydney Kirker with 14 followed by Emma Marthins (12) and Destiny Goodnight (11). Asia Crim led the defense with 28 digs.
  • Head Coach Jordan Barton earned her first win as the program's head coach in the sweep over Baldwin Wallace.
